Створення веб-сайту – це тривалий процес, і ваша робота не закінчується після його запуску. Вам потрібно підтримувати та оновлювати ваш сайт, щоб він залишався актуальним та безпечним. Регулярно додавайте новий контент, оновлюйте дизайн та функціональність, а також слідкуйте за безпекою вашого сайту. Перед тим, як розпочати створення веб-сайту, необхідно визначити його ціль та цільову аудиторію.
Використання на бекенді У веб-розробці C# в основному використовується для створення бекенд-логіки веб-додатків, серверних компонентів та веб-служб. Зважаючи на вимоги до масштабованості та продуктивності вашого проекту розробки веб-сайту (CWDP). Якщо ви плануєте розширити свій веб-сайт або витримувати зростання навантаження в найближчому майбутньому, вам необхідно вибрати мову, яка буде відповідати розширенню. Виберіть мову з чудовою швидкістю виконання, яка може ефективно вирішувати складні завдання і забезпечує приємний досвід користувача.
Версії та еволюція HTML розвинулася з простої мови для створення гіпертекстових документів до потужного інструменту для побудови складних веб-інтерфейсів. Основні версії HTML включають HTML 2.zero (1995), HTML three.2 (1997), HTML four.01 (1999) та HTML5 (2014). HTML5 є найновішою та найбільш широко використовуваною версією, яка додала нові семантичні елементи, мультимедійні можливості та API для створення багатших веб-додатків. Поширене використання з Angular та React TypeScript широко використовується у фреймворках, таких як Angular та React. Angular, розроблений Google, був написаний з використанням TypeScript і активно заохочує його використання.
JavaScript – це одна з найбільш популярних мов для веб-розробки, яка підходить як для фронтенду, так і для бекенду (через Node.js). Завдяки великій кількості навчальних матеріалів, форумів та інструментів для розробників, JavaScript є чудовим вибором для тих, хто тільки починає. Вивчивши його, ви зможете створювати інтерактивні сайти та додатки, а також працювати з іншими технологіями, такими як React або Angular. Python заслужив любов розробників завдяки своїй простоті та читабельності коду. У веб-розробці Python широко відомий завдяки таким фреймворкам, як Django і Flask, які пропонують готові рішення для розробки веб-додатків. Python стає дедалі популярнішим у веброзробці завдяки своїй простоті та багатству бібліотек.
Супутні Технології
Якщо будете розбиратися у технологіях, зможете налагодити ефективнішу комунікацію з командою розробників. Знання технічних аспектів — ключ до подолання можливих обмежень і пошуку причин виникнення труднощів або затримок. Це полегшує процес роботи та дає команді зрозуміти, що вони можуть покластися на свого керівника. Мультипарадигменні мови – це ті, які підтримують кілька парадигм програмування.
Веб-сайти стають розумнішими, здатними адаптуватися під кожного користувача на основі його вподобань і поведінки. Крім того, інструменти, які використовують ШІ для тестування та моніторингу, дозволяють значно скоротити час на розробку та підвищити якість кінцевого продукту. Не забувайте також про підтримку технологій та фреймворків, які можуть прискорити розробку, а також про майбутнє розширення сайту. Вибір мови має бути орієнтований на ваші довгострокові цілі та можливість розвитку проекту. Це дозволяє уникнути багатьох помилок, які можуть виникнути під час розробки великих JavaScript-проектів.
Має безліч фреймворків, які спрощують і прискорюють процес створення вебсайтів і додатків, а також багатий набір бібліотек для роботи з даними. Це робить Pyhton ідеальним вибором для створення сучасних продуктів, пов’язаних з аналізом даних або машинним навчанням. Це дозволяє додавати кольори, шрифти, макети та анімацію до вашого веб-сайту, роблячи його візуально привабливим.
Це тому, що, хоча HTML і CSS, безумовно, не одне і те ж, вони є взаємодоповнюючими мовами, які найкраще функціонують, коли використовуються в тандемі, тому вивчення обох – чудовий старт. Супутні технології, такі як HTML, CSS та системи управління контентом (CMS), відіграють важливу роль у створенні структурованого, привабливого та зручного для керування веб-контенту. Опис та призначення TypeScript є мовою програмування з відкритим вихідним кодом, розробленою Microsoft.
- Він легко інтегрується з більшістю веб-серверів і баз даних, що робить його ідеальним для багатьох веб-проектів.
- Вибір мови для фронтенду і бекенду залежить від функціональних вимог проекту та бажаного результату.
- У вересні 2023 р.Геннадій був найрейтинговішим програмістом за версією CodeForces, Code Chef, High Coder, AtCoder, я Hacker rank.
Його Понад 2 мільярди рядків коду можуть бути об’єднані в один репозиторій. Google має власне програмне забезпечення для контролю версій, засноване на Trunk. JavaScript і Python, дві найвідоміші мови у сфері стартапів, мова програмування це користуються великим попитом. Багато стартапів використовують серверні платформи, засновані на Python, такі як Django (Python), Flask (Python) і NodeJS (JavaScript). Python – це гнучка високорівнева система обробки даних, в якій наголос робиться на простоту і зручність читання.
Vuejs
Його широко використовують великі технологічні компанії, такі як Google, Dropbox та Uber. Використання на бекенді Ruby в основному використовується для розробки бекенду веб-додатків. Деякі мови програмування, такі як JavaScript, PHP, Python, Ruby, зосереджені на веб-розробці з самого початку свого створення. Інші, наприклад Java та C#, є більш загальними, але мають потужні бібліотеки та фреймворки для створення веб-додатків. Популярність певної мови часто визначається її гнучкістю, продуктивністю, наявністю великої спільноти розробників та багатством екосистеми бібліотек і інструментів.
Саме тому, вони стають дедалі популярнішими, оскільки дають змогу розробникам створювати складніші та ефективніші програми. Go, розроблений Google, зарекомендував себе як мова з високою продуктивністю для серверної сторони, особливо при роботі з конкурентними операціями і мікросервісами. Тим не менш, ті, хто має певний досвід програмування, хто хоче розширити власний набір навичок, можуть виявити, що Go насправді досить проста і зрозуміла. Swift був розроблений Apple спеціально для використання з macOS, iOS, watchOS та tvOS. І оскільки Apple є таким великим гравцем на арені мобільних пристроїв, Swift також став важливою частиною стеку IoT.